摘要:
精神分裂症是严重危害人类健康的严重性精神障碍,临床异质性极大,其防治一直是全球性医学难题。精神分裂症的临床症状复杂多样,因此基于阳性症状对精神分裂症进行亚分型具有十分重要的临床意义。幻听是精神分裂症的主要症状之一,高达60%~90%的患者伴有幻听症状,这也是精神分裂症诊断标准中的一项重要内容,因此幻听目前已被认为是精神分裂症的核心临床症状,阐明这一症状的神经机制对于进一步理解其疾病本质具有十分重要的科学意义和临床价值。现通过系统回顾精神分裂症幻听的磁共振成像(MRI)研究相关文献,探讨精神分裂症幻听研究现状及神经机制。
Abstract:
Schizophrenia is a serious mental disorder that seriously endangers human health,with great clinical heterogeneity,so its prevention and treatment are global challenges in medicine.The clinical symptoms of schizophrenia are complex and diverse,so it is of great significance to subtype schizophrenia based on positive symptoms.Auditory hallucination is one of the main symptoms of schizophrenia,with up to 60% to 90% of patients suffening from auditory hallucination symptoms,which is also an important part of the diagnostic criteria of schizophrenia.Therefore,auditory hallucinations have been considered as the core clinical symptoms of schizophrenia.Elucidation of its neural mechanism and deep understanding of this serious mental disorder have important scientific and clinical significance.This paper reviews the MRI research literature on schizophrenia auditory hallucinations in a systematic way,discussies the current status and neural mechanism of auditory hallucination in schizophrenia.
